We're looking for a Data Engineer to join our Insurance Money and Services team.

As a Data Engineer, you'll build and maintain data flows and data acquisition processes to deliver well-structured, efficient, and performant data marts to drive business analysis and processes. Reporting to the Data Engineering Lead(s), you'll support them through the delivery of projects, work within deadlines, escalate risks or issues promptly, and ensure that daily activities are delivered within SLAs.

You'll liaise with stakeholders at all levels, delivering end-to-end data requests and ensuring a single version of the truth across the organisation.

What you'll be doing

  1. Data Collection and Analysis: Produce accurate reports by collecting data from various sources and inputting it into standard formats. Identify and monitor Data & BI risks and report any business impact with solutions to the Data Engineering Lead(s).
  2. Application Development: Contribute to developing existing and new SAS-based applications, analyzing and identifying areas for improvement to meet customer requirements.
  3. Product/Service Development: Solve known problems and deliver outcomes using existing systems.
  4. Technical Developments Recommendation: Work with the Data & BI team to develop and maintain a comprehensive data warehouse using SAS/SQL, ensuring data is clearly defined and consistently maintained.
  5. Data Governance: Develop and maintain data dictionaries, supporting aspects of data quality, security, management, architecture, availability, and performance.
  6. Troubleshooting and Debugging: Provide fault isolation and resolution promptly.
  7. Project Management: Process Data & BI requests efficiently, ensuring data accuracy and audits, and liaising with stakeholders to improve business performance.
